Laredo Police Saved Woman Held Captive for 3 days

 On December 9th, at approximately 8:30 pm, Laredo Police Department CID CAPERS Division received information regarding a possible kidnapping of an unknown female.  A subsequent investigation revealed that that a female victim was being held against her will at an unknown location.  Detectives later discovered & identified a suspect and the location, 1800 Country Club, where the victim was being held.  Detectives confirmed the information from different sources that indicated that the victim was in imminent danger or feared dead due to the suspect’s belligerent behavior and history of carrying firearms.  LPD CID Detectives immediately attempted to make contact with the occupants at 1800 Country Club to no avail.

 Based on exigent circumstances, LPD Detectives and Patrol Officers gained entry to the condominium.  Laredo Police Detectives and Patrol Officers discovered Rolando Rubio and the victim in an upstairs bedroom.  A subsequent investigation by police revealed that the victim had visible injuries on her body and that she had been held against her will since Monday.     

 Rolando Rubio was immediately taken into custody without incident; he was taken to the Laredo Police Department, where he was booked and charged with Aggravated Assault F/2 and Unlawful Restraint F/3.  Rubio was taken to Webb County Jail pending bond.  

 A subsequent execution of State Search Warrant at the 1800 Country Club by Detectives resulted in the seizure of multiple items to include weapons and ammunition.  Additional state and federal firearms violations charges are still pending.
